Today Uliflex will introduce to you how to calculate the conveyor belt line speed
We first need to get the basic value:
Reducer 1400 rpm, speed ratio 6.57
Roller diameter: 112mm
Driving sprocket 36Z (tooth)
Driven sprocket 18Z (tooth)
How do we calculate the line speed of the conveyor belt after we know these data?
The calculation method is as follows:
(The thickness of 112+2t conveyor belt)×3.14×1400÷57÷6×36÷18=xxx (mm/min)
1. The motor power of the belt conveyor should be comprehensively calculated based on the belt width, conveying distance, inclination angle, conveying volume, and material characteristics and humidity.
2. The belt conveyor is a friction-driven machine that transports materials in a continuous manner. It is mainly composed of frame, conveyor belt, roller, roller, tensioning device, transmission device, etc. It can form a material conveying process on a certain conveying line from the initial feeding point to the final unloading point. It can carry out the transportation of broken materials and the transportation of finished items. In addition to pure material transportation, it can also be matched with the requirements of the technological process in the production process of various industrial enterprises to form a rhythmic assembly line.
3. Conveyor belt Conveyor is also called belt conveyor. The conveyor belt moves according to the principle of friction transmission and is suitable for all kinds of conveying. According to the properties of materials, it can be divided into light conveyor belts and heavy conveyor belts.
